Voting When You Already Know the Results: Electoral Information and Strategic Coordination in Peru’s 2026 Presidential Election

Abstract: When voters receive real-time information about an ongoing election, do they coordinate strategically — and does that coordination respect ideological boundaries? I argue that viability signals produce ideologically bounded coordination: voters shift toward the most viable candidate within their political neighborhood rather than gravitating toward any national leader. To test this, I exploit a natural experiment in Peru's 2026 presidential election, where a logistical failure caused some polling stations to vote one day late, after partial results were already public, generating exogenous variation in information access across otherwise comparable voters. Informed voters concentrated their votes roughly 57 percent more than uninformed voters. A further test reveals that concentration rose sharply within the centrist bloc but not the right bloc, consistent with within-bloc rather than cross-ideological coordination. These findings illuminate how strategic voting operates under extreme party fragmentation and suggest that information revelation may strengthen rather than distort electoral representation.
